'Best player in the world' - Tottenham fans make claim after dominant first half vs Newcastle

Tottenham Hotspur's return to action after the international break was a highly-anticipated one.

The Lilywhites endured a torrid September, losing all three of their Premier League fixtures, falling to a 3-0 defeat against Crystal Palace and Chelsea before local rivals Arsenal blew them away in the first half of the North London Derby as Mikel Arteta's side clinched a 3-1 victory at the Emirates Stadium.

However, Spurs bounced back against Aston Villa earlier this month, securing a 2-1 win before international football offered a two-week hiatus from club football.

Now, the north Londoners travelled to face Newcastle United at St James' Park, with the Tyneside-based club playing their first match since Mike Ashley decided to sell the club to Amanda Staveley's Saudi-led consortium.

The Magpies took an early lead as Callum Wilson broke the deadlock in the second minute before Tanguy Ndombele equalised for Spurs, delivering an impressive curled finish past Karl Darlow in the Newcastle goal.

Spurs centre-forward Harry Kane then fired Nuno Espirito Santo's side in front, the 28-year-old's first Premier League goal of the season before South Korean international Son Heung-Min scored a third just before halftime.
